Slow Cooker Cooking: It Warms the Soul

My fans have let me know how much they enjoy crockpot cooking, so I love including slow cooker recipes on the website and in my cookbooks. Slow cookers allow busy families the chance to come home to long-simmered soups, sauces, stews and other comforting meals that warm the soul. The trick to developing or converting recipes for slow cookers is to correctly estimate the liquid needed. Figure that about 2 cups of liquid will be evaporated during the cooking process over six to eight hours, so plan accordingly. For instance, if you want to make chicken soup or minestrone soup […]

Easy Crockpot Apple Butter

Don’t be fooled by the title, this is a completely dairy-free recipe! With seasonal apples, naturally sweet dates and warming spices this recipe will not only taste delicious on a slice of toast but also make your kitchen smell divine! The quercetin in the apples will help boost your immune system. Ingredients 5 pounds of apples, peeled and chopped 3 tsp. ground cinnamon 1/2 tsp. ground nutmeg 1/4 tsp. ground cloves 1 tsp. pure vanilla extract 4-5 medjool dates, pitted 2 Tbs. water or orange juice 1/4 tsp. sea salt Instructions 1.
